The La Liga meeting at Power Horse Stadium on Sunday will see home side UD Almería do battle with Villarreal.

UD Almería enter this fixture following on from a 2-2 La Liga drawn game vs Real Sociedad.
In that game, UD Almería had 50% possession and 7 shots at goal with 3 of them on target. The scorer for UD Almería was Adri Embarba (30', 88'). For their opponents, Real Sociedad got 17 attempts on goal with 4 of them on target. Sheraldo Becker (32') and Mikel Oyarzabal (59') scored for Real Sociedad.
It’s been a rare occasion in recent times that UD Almería have managed to hold out for a full 90 minutes. The reality is that UD Almería have been scored against in 5 of their previous 6 games, letting in 10 goals on the way. It will be interesting to see whether or not that trend can be continued on in this game.
Pre-game facts show that UD Almería:
- haven't beaten Villarreal in their last 11 matches in the league.
- haven’t won at home in the past 16 league games. It has been a terrible run.

In their previous fixture, Villarreal drew 1-1 in the La Liga tie with Athletic Bilbao.
In that game, Villarreal managed 47% possession and 10 shots at goal with 2 of them on target. The only player on the scoresheet for Villarreal was Dani Parejo (95'). Athletic Bilbao had 13 shots on goal with 6 on target. Oihan Sancet (66') was the scorer for Athletic Bilbao.
The stats tell the story, and Villarreal have been scored against in 5 of their last 6 games, conceding 10 goals in all. In defence, Villarreal have clearly had some problems.
Leading up to this clash, Villarreal:
- haven't been defeated by UD Almería when they have played them away from home in the previous 5 league games. A solid away record against them.
- are undefeated in their last 5 away league matches.

Checking on past results between these clubs going back to 15/03/2015 tells us that these fixtures have not been good ones for UD Almería. They’ve not been able to register any victories at all whereas Villarreal have dominated them, running out winners in 67 per cent of those ties.
There were also goals galore in those games, with 22 overall at an average of 3.67 goals per meeting.
The previous league encounter between these clubs was La Liga match day 5 on 17/09/2023 when it ended Villarreal 2-1 UD Almería.
In that game, Villarreal managed 63% possession and 10 attempts on goal with 4 on target. Goals were scored by Gerard Moreno (45') and Alexander Sørloth (94').
At the other end, UD Almería had 17 shots on goal with 7 on target. Sergio Akieme (44') was the scorer.
The referee was Francisco José Hernández Maeso.

The UD Almería manager Pepe Mel will be happy not to have any fitness concerns to speak of ahead of this clash thanks to a completely injury-free group to choose from.
It’s our opinion that UD Almería look set to use a 4-2-3-1 formation in the match with Luis Maximiano, Marc Pubill, Cesar Montes, Juan Brandariz, Bruno Langa, Lucas Robertone, Dion Lopy, Leo Baptistao, Jonathan Viera, Adrian Embarba and Anthony Lozano.
📰 Team News: Villarreal
Villarreal manager Marcelino García Toral has a number of players out of action. Yéremy Pino (Cruciate ligament surgery) and Denis Suárez (Tendon rupture) are not able to play.
We are inclined to think that El Submarino Amarillo could decide to play in a 4-4-2 formation, starting Filip Joergensen, Kiko, Aissa Mandi, Yerson Mosquera, Alfonso Pedraza, Ilias Akhomach, Daniel Parejo, Francis Coquelin, Alejandro Baena, Gerard Moreno and Alexander Soerloth.
